I have an 89 ix auto (I know, I know). I noticed after about 3k miles the transmission needed about a qt of fluid. I checked and it looks like the leak is coming from between transmission and the transfer case. I checked the transfer case and it is full and not coming from the weep-hole. Also I replaced the pan gasket and filter (fluid looks great and taste like chicken). Is there a seal or something else in the back of the transmission that may be leaking? Thanks
